Rapid City, South Dakota vs Mogoca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Rapid City, South Dakota, Usa and Mogoca, Russia is approximately 8,397 km or 5,218 mi.
  • To reach Rapid City, South Dakota in this distance one would set out from Mogoca bearing 30.4°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Rapid City, South Dakota bearing 155.4° or SSE .
  • Rapid City, South Dakota has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Mogoca has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c).
  • Rapid City, South Dakota is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Mogoca is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
  • The average temperature is 13.1 °C (23.7°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.7 °C (31.9°F) less in Rapid City, South Dakota.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 27.9 mm (1.1 in) more which is equivalent to 27.9 l/m² (0.68 US gal/ft²) or 279,000 l/ha (29,827 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.6° higher in Rapid City, South Dakota than in Mogoca.
